Output d4f7654b59d28912cc23ba4e102f59fcb59eea1cf003a0aad26f01a90780eb88:0

value
2686909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d39ca35dc3b60d294039d188c8a61d390794f73 OP_EQUAL
address
34MYkRDjCc6UxWBFiTPWxQktDRop1MKSEX
transaction
d4f7654b59d28912cc23ba4e102f59fcb59eea1cf003a0aad26f01a90780eb88